Built for People Moving Across States
Moving Without Stress is focused mainly on long-distance and interstate moving in the United States.
That focus matters.
A local move across town is very different from a move across state lines. The pricing, rules, timelines, delivery windows, risks, and company expectations can all change once your move becomes long distance.
